Product


Constellation Energy Corporation (CEG) offers a diverse portfolio of energy-related products, focusing on both sustainability and technological advancements in the following key areas:

  • Electricity Generation, Transmission, and Distribution: Constellation operates approximately 32,000 megawatts of generating capacity, reflecting a significant presence in nuclear, coal, gas, hydroelectric, and renewable generation sources.
  • Clean and Renewable Energy Solutions: CEG is a leading provider of clean energy, particularly through solar and wind power. The company has installed over 2,200 megawatts of wind capacity and, as of the latest report, 1,500 megawatts in solar power projects.
  • Energy Management Systems: Constellation offers energy management solutions that optimize energy use for efficiency and cost-effectiveness. These systems are increasingly adopted by commercial and industrial facilities, aiming to reduce their carbon footprint and energy expenses.
  • Natural Gas Supply: Constellation Energy supplies natural gas to over 1.8 million customers across multiple states, with major markets including Maryland, Pennsylvania, and Ohio. The annual distribution volume represents significant capacities exceeding 250,000 million cubic feet.

The integration of renewable energy sources and innovative energy management technologies in Constellation’s product offerings aligns with global energy trends and the increasing consumer demand for sustainable and efficient energy solutions. The development and expansion of these technologies are crucial for maintaining competitive advantage in the evolving energy market.


Place


The strategic location and distribution channels of Constellation Energy Corporation (CEG) significantly influence its market reach and customer accessibility. Here’s an examination of the company’s operations in terms of geographical placement and service delivery modalities:

  • Geographical Coverage: Constellation operates primarily within the United States, delivering energy solutions extensively across areas with deregulated markets. This includes key states such as Texas, Maryland, Pennsylvania, and Illinois, where energy market deregulation provides a competitive landscape for providers.
  • Digital and Physical Presence: As of the latest reports, Constellation manages a robust online platform that facilitates seamless account management, service modifications, and payment processes for customers. This digital solution emphasizes the company’s commitment to leveraging technology to enhance customer experience and operational efficiency. In addition to its digital platform, Constellation maintains a significant physical presence. The company has its corporate headquarters located in Baltimore, Maryland and operates numerous local service centers across its active states, ensuring a tangible presence that supports customer service and operational logistics.
  • Distributed Energy and Sustainability Services: Reflecting its strategic focus on sustainability and modern energy solutions, Constellation offers distributed energy resources, including solar and wind power. These initiatives not only address customer demand for renewable energy options but also align with broader regulatory and market trends emphasizing sustainability. Through its subsidiary, Constellation Solar, the company has implemented numerous projects that showcase its capacity and commitment to renewable energy.

Constellation Energy’s effective utilization of both physical and digital channels in its operational geography optimizes its market coverage and enhances its ability to deliver diversified energy solutions, thereby maintaining a strong competitive position in the energy sector.

Price


Constellation Energy Corporation utilizes competitive pricing strategies tailored specifically for deregulated markets. This approach allows the company to adapt prices based on current market conditions, enhancing their ability to attract diverse customer segments.

The company provides both variable and fixed-rate plans for electricity and natural gas. As of the latest fiscal year, they offer variable plans where rates can change month-to-month based on market conditions, alongside fixed-rate plans where prices are locked in for periods ranging from 12 to 36 months, alleviating concerns about price volatility for consumers.

  • Variable plans adapt to market conditions, giving consumers potential cost benefits during lower rate periods.
  • Fixed-rate plans provide stability, helping customers budget more effectively by protecting them against price spikes.

Constellation Energy Corporation also incentivizes longer commitment from customers through discounts and special rates for long-term contracts and setups for automatic payments. These discounts often result in a 5-10% reduction in monthly bills, depending on the current promotional terms and customer eligibility.

Their pricing tiers are structured based on usage and peak demand periods. Typically, the company provides lower rates during off-peak hours to encourage energy usage when there is less strain on the grid, potentially reducing overall energy costs for proactive consumers. Peak hours usually occur from late afternoon to early evening, particularly on weekdays.

  • Lower rates during off-peak hours can result in up to 20% savings on energy bills for consumers who can shift significant portions of their usage to these times.
  • Pricing tiers help manage demand on the energy grid, ensuring more stable service across the network.

Each pricing strategy and structure is openly communicated to consumers through transparent billing and detailed descriptions of how rates are calculated and applied, assisting in maintaining a high level of customer trust and satisfaction.
